Welcome aboard. You'll be managing releases for Marqette, our diagram editor. The big item this cycle is the reworked undo/redo stack: history is now persisted per-document, so test that redo survives an autosave before approving any build. Release candidates come from the Ashgrove pipeline nightly; reject anything that fails the history regression suite. All approved builds must be signed before distribution, and for verifying what's already shipped, the current release signing key follows below.

release key, fafof-kahog: bky4_hWtU

Runbook: flaky websocket reconnects in the Twinebridge gateway. If your plugin sees repeated 1006 closes, it's usually the keepalive ping racing our session resume — bump your ping interval above 25s and honor the resume nonce we send on reconnect. Still stuck? Reproduce against the sandbox gateway and grab the trace token printed below.

session token of tajef-bageg = htk21_5d90d574934f3ccae6437

Subject: Tracing setup for the Quillbrook integration

Hi, and welcome aboard. As you wire your services into the Quillbrook mesh, please propagate our trace header on every outbound call, including retries — dropped headers are the main reason spans appear orphaned in the Lanternview dashboard. Sampling is set to 20% in staging, so don't panic if some requests vanish. To query the trace API directly while you're validating your integration, authenticate with the token below.

login token, yagaf-hawip: eyJhbGciOiJIUzI1NiIsInR5cCI6IkpXVCJ9.eyJzdWIiOiIdHjlcNIn0.AFyH-u9q